Why ChatGPT Cover Letters Get Filtered Out
The problem with AI-assisted cover letters is not only that they sound generated. It is that they often sound like they could belong to anyone, which weakens the application before a recruiter even reaches the details.

Generic ChatGPT letters lose specificity
ChatGPT defaults to vague enthusiasm. Hiring managers want concrete examples and a real voice — both are lost in a raw AI draft.
